Good News! CA Drivers Shouldn't Be Tazed Over Minor Traffic Violations

. . . and you thought this was a no brainer? Yet the holding is derived from a recent decision of the US Court of Appeals for the Ninth Circuit in a case where Coronado, California Police Officer Brian McPherson blasted motorist Carl Bryan, then 21, with a 1200-volt taser during a traffic stop over a minor infraction on the Coronado Bridge near San Diego, five years ago. Bryan lost four of his front teeth and was hit with “resisting arrest” charges. He sued, claiming excessive force had been used. The court held that the intermediate, significant level of force delivered by a taser must be justified by a significant threat to the officer. Bryan's seatbelt infraction was not enough.
